In This Episode

Erika Reyna’s story highlights the potential link between breast implants and chronic inflammatory symptoms. Having worn breast implants for over a decade, she initially dismissed symptoms such as brain fog, memory loss, and severe fatigue as typical postpartum exhaustion. However, her condition worsened to the point where she was unable to get up from her living room floor. It was only when her mother intervened that she began to reconsider her health. Following her explant surgery, Erika experienced a remarkable transformation within 24 hours, including a significant reduction in inflammation and visible physical changes. Her account underscores the importance of recognizing that what may seem like normal tiredness or postpartum fatigue could be related to underlying issues associated with breast implants. She emphasizes that the hardest step may be giving oneself permission to acknowledge that something is wrong, rather than dismissing symptoms. The episode discusses how denial can be an early symptom of breast implant illness and explores the connection between chronic inflammation and symptoms such as cognitive difficulties. Erika’s experience also challenges the misconception that recovery from explant surgery is slow, illustrating a rapid improvement post-procedure. Additionally, the conversation touches on the role of genetic testing for families affected by chronic inflammatory conditions, providing a broader perspective on health and wellness related to breast implants.
